Ranger 2WD V6-182 3.0L (1995)
Brake ON/OFF Switch: Description and Operation
Brake ON/OFF Switch
The mechanical brake ON/OFF switch is installed onto the pin of the brake pedal arm. It straddles the vacuum booster input rod, but is not attached
directly to the input rod. The brake ON/OFF switch moves with the pedal arm when the brake pedal (2455) is pressed.
The circuit from the brake ON/OFF switch to the stoplamps provides a signal indicating the brake pedal has been pressed. The signal is routed to the
following electrical Systems:
-
Electronic engine control (EEC)
-
Brake shift interlock
-
Electronic 4-wheel drive
-
Anti-lock brake (ABS)
-
Speed control
-
Generic electronic module (GEM)
-
Trailer tow
-
Adaptive suspension
